What is Spectrum

Spectrum is a cable television provider that offers a variety of channels to customers across the United States. With Spectrum, you can access local, regional, and national programming, including news, sports, and entertainment. Spectrum also offers a range of internet and phone services, making it a popular choice for consumers who want to bundle their telecommunications services.

What is Fox

Fox is a popular television network that offers a wide range of programming, including news, sports, and entertainment. Some of the most popular shows on Fox include “The Simpsons,” “Family Guy,” and “Empire.” In addition to its programming, Fox also airs a variety of live sports events, including NFL football, MLB baseball, and NASCAR racing.

Spectrum Channel Lineup

Before we dive into where to find Fox channels on Spectrum, it’s essential to understand how Spectrum organizes its channel lineup. Spectrum offers several channel packages, each with a different set of channels, so the channel lineup can vary depending on the package you have.

The most basic package is Spectrum TV Select, which includes over 125 channels. The next package up is Spectrum TV Silver, which offers over 175 channels, and the most comprehensive package is Spectrum TV Gold, which includes over 200 channels.

What to Do if You Can’t Find Fox on Spectrum

If you’re having trouble finding Fox on Spectrum, there are a few things you can do:

  1. Check your package: Make sure that Fox is included in your Spectrum package. If it’s not, you may need to upgrade your package to access the channel.
  2. Reset your cable box: Sometimes, resetting your cable box can help resolve issues with missing channels. Try unplugging your cable box for a few minutes and then plugging it back in to see if that helps.
  3. Contact Spectrum customer service: If all else fails, contact Spectrum customer service for assistance. They should be able to help you resolve any issues you’re experiencing with missing channels.
